Output ffd889712bd30c66b2db13a28f8f904b67154666242ef867992550138c8b580b:1

value
21758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d9315ded0511fecd01d4106e9cf92e35aa5b72 OP_EQUAL
address
3QNogwWunndNr7pqi3eCByUVoGoLYxjcK1
transaction
ffd889712bd30c66b2db13a28f8f904b67154666242ef867992550138c8b580b